#34d448 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#34d448 is composed of 20.4% red, 83.1%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 66%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 127.5 degrees, a saturation of 65% and a lightness of 51.8%. #34d448 color hex could be obtained by blending #68ff90 with #00a900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

● #34d448 color description : Strong lime green.
#34d448 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#34d448 has RGB values of R:52, G:212,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0, Y:0.66,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 3462216.
